Falcons' James Pearce Jr. suspended eight games by NFL
Summary

The NFL has suspended Falcons edge rusher James Pearce Jr. for eight games due to felony charges from a domestic violence incident. Coach Kevin Stefanski confirmed the news following a preseason loss. Pearce, who recorded 10½ sacks in 2025, will play in preseason before serving the suspension starting August 30. His absence adds to the Falcons' challenges, including the recent loss of linebacker Jalon Walker to a torn ACL. The team faces additional uncertainty as competition for the starting quarterback job continues amid injuries to key players.
